Thu, 5 Feb 2009: Contrarian (Logical) Commercial Real Estate Investing Not For the Timid
Every market has it's cycles, up and down. The adage, "buy when everyone is selling and sell when everyone is buying" certainly makes sense but it takes steady nerves to follow that sage advise because it runs against the herd instinct. The current US real estate market cycle is at or near the bottom and there are bargains everywhere.

Thu, 5 Feb 2009: Speculative Equity - What Is It and How to Get It?
People who purchase real estate use the phrase "building equity" to describe the overall increase in equity over time. However, most people think in terms of capturing speculative equity, the equity gained from other speculators bidding up prices.

Tue, 20 Jan 2009: Renting Versus Owning Residential Real Estate
Renting versus owning is both an intellectual, financial decision and an emotional decision. The financial decision is first and foremost an analysis of the comparative cost of renting versus owning. It makes no sense to pay more than rental equivalence to own residential real estate.

Mon, 19 Jan 2009: The Home Mortgage Interest Deduction is Widely Overestimated and Misunderstood
Debt subsidies, in particular the home mortgage interest deduction, are seen as a great benefit to home ownership. The benefit is widely overestimated and misunderstood.
